View Single Post
  #3 (permalink)  
Old 11-20-2007, 05:54 PM
deugenin deugenin is offline
Project Contributor
 
Posts: 65
Default

Thanks for your reply Greg, but I still with the problem... :-(

Mi new Tab its appears on Domain view, but OUTPUT and TEXTAREA it's not appears (the tab is clear)...


Mi devel.js is:

-------------------------------------------------------------------------------------------
function DevelExtension() {}

DevelExtension.DomainXFormModifier = function (xFormObject) {

//find _TAB_BAR_ element
var cnt = xFormObject.items.length;
for(i = 0; i < cnt; i++) {
if(xFormObject.items[i].type=="tab_bar") break;
}
//get a tab index
var myTabIndex = ++ZaDomainXFormView.TAB_INDEX;

//add a tab
xFormObject.items[i].choices.push({value:myTabIndex, label:"Devel Tab"});

//define a form for my new tab.
var myTab = {type:_CASE_, relevant"instance[ZaModel.currentTab] == " + myTabIndex),
items:[
{ ref:ZaDomain.A_domainName, type:_OUTPUT_,
label:ZaMsg.Domain_DomainName
},
{ ref:ZaDomain.A_notes, type:_TEXTAREA_,
label:"Texto Devel", labelCssStyle:"vertical-align:top", width:250
}
]
};

//find SWITCH element
for(i = 0; i < cnt; i++) {
if(xFormObject.items[i].type=="switch") break;
}

//add my tab to the form
xFormObject.items[i].items.push(myTab);
}

ZaTabView.XFormModifiers["ZaDomainXFormView"].push(DevelExtension.DomainXFormModifier);

-------------------------------------------------------------------------------------------
__________________
Daniel Eugenin
http://www.it-linux.cl
Reply With Quote